The sets L and D are given below:

L= { -2, -1, 0, 2, 6, 7} D = {2, 3, 6} Find the union of L and D. Find the intersection of L and D. Write your answers using set notation (in roster form).

Final answer:

The union of L and D is {-2, -1, 0, 2, 3, 6, 7}. The intersection of L and D is {2, 6}.

Step-by-step explanation:

The union of two sets, L and D, is the set that contains all the elements from both sets. To find the union of L and D, we combine all the elements without repeating them. In this case, the union of L and D is { -2, -1, 0, 2, 3, 6, 7}.

The intersection of two sets, L and D, is the set that contains all the elements that are common to both sets. To find the intersection of L and D, we identify the elements that are present in both sets. In this case, the intersection of L and D is { 2, 6}.
